Renovations on Tap for Home of Wilmington Sharks
Commissioners in New Hanover County (NC) voted 4-0 Monday in favor of spending about $50,000 to help with improvements to Buck Hardee Field, home of the summer collegiate Wilmington Sharks (Coastal Plain League). The Sharks will pay for half of the $325,000 renovation project, with three government entities picking up the tab for the other half. Read more here and here.

Sharks Employee Dies at Ballpark
The summer collegiate Wilmington Shark (Coastal Plain League) called off their game with the Fayetteville SwampDogs Monday night, as the team’s devoted equipment manager Kevin Cerasuolo collapsed and died in the team’s clubhouse just before the the Sharks were scheduled to take batting practice. He was in his late 30s. Read more and view news report here.

Wilmington Sharks Extend Lease Through 2016
Despite rumors about the possible return of professional baseball to Wilmington (NC), the city and the summer collegiate Wilmington Sharks (Coastal Plain League) and have quietly worked out a deal to extend the Sharks’ lease of Buck Hardee Field for five more years. An official announcement is expected today at 10:00 a.m. at the ballpark. Read more here and here.
